Compartilhar via


HidP_SetButtons macro (hidpi.h)

A macro HidP_SetButtons é um alias mnemônico para a função HidP_SetUsages.

Sintaxe

#define HidP_SetButtons(Rty, Up, Lco, ULi, ULe, Ppd, Rep, Rle) \
        HidP_SetUsages(Rty, Up, Lco, ULi, ULe, Ppd, Rep, Rle)

Parâmetros

[in] Rty

Especifica um valor de enumerador HIDP_REPORT_TYPE que indica o tipo de relatório localizado em Rep.

[in] Up

Especifica o da página de uso para os usos especificados pelo ULi.

[in] Lco

Especifica a coleção de links que contém os usos. Se Lco não for zero, a rotina definirá apenas os usos, se existirem, nesta coleção de links. Se Lco for zero, a rotina definirá o primeiro uso para cada uso especificado na coleção de de nível superior associada a ppd.

[in, out] ULi

Ponteiro para a matriz de usos.

[in, out] ULe

Especifica, na entrada, o número de usos em ULi. Consulte a seção Comentários para obter informações sobre o valor de saída.

[in] Ppd

Ponteiro para o de dados pré-analisados da coleção de nível superior associada ao relatório localizado em Rep.

[in] Rep

Ponteiro para um relatório.

[in] Rle

Especifica o tamanho, em bytes, do relatório localizado em Rep, que deve ser igual ao comprimento do relatório para o tipo de relatório especificado que HidP_GetCaps retorna na estrutura HIDP_CAPS de uma coleção.

Valor de retorno

Nenhum

Observações

Consulte HidP_SetUsages para obter detalhes do valor retornado.

Requisitos

Requisito Valor
de cliente com suporte mínimo Disponível no Windows 2000 e versões posteriores do Windows.
da Plataforma de Destino Universal
cabeçalho hidpi.h (inclua hidpi.h)

Consulte também